Ukraine-Russia War Escalates | Israel’s Role in Global Power | Trump v Elon & Epstein Revelations

66 min • 6 juni 2025

The conversation delves into the escalating conflict between Ukraine and Russia, focusing on recent attacks, military strategies, and the implications of labeling Ukraine as a terrorist state. It discusses the involvement of Western intelligence, the perceptions of war among Russians, and the role of British intelligence in the conflict. The speakers also explore the challenges of insurgency and the need for a shift in Western support for Ukraine, as well as Israel's complicated position regarding the war. In this conversation, Peter Erickson discusses the complex interplay of geopolitical interests, particularly focusing on Israel's strategic maneuvers in relation to the United States and the ongoing conflict in Ukraine. He explores the potential compromises of political leaders, the public's perception of ethnic cleansing in Gaza, and the disconnect between elite political support for Israel and the growing dissent among the general populace. The discussion also touches on the implications of surveillance technologies and the potential paths forward for Western hegemony, including the risks of financial collapse and the possibility of revolution.
